How they compare

Austria currently reports 4,871 1000 USD against 4,161 1000 USD in Portugal, a difference of 710 1000 USD.

That makes Austria's figure about 1.2 times Portugal's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 17 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Austria ahead.

Austria ranks 21st and Portugal ranks 23rd of 61 countries.

Austria has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
